Invasive meningococcal disease: secondary spread in a day-care center

Two invasive meningococcal disease cases in a day-care center highlight the risk of secondary spread. Prompt reporting, rifampin prophylaxis, and potential immunization are crucial control measures for invasive meningococcal disease.

Background:

  • Invasive meningococcal disease (IMD) poses a significant public health risk, particularly in congregate settings like day-care centers.
  • Secondary transmission of Neisseria meningitidis within day-care facilities is a documented concern.
  • Understanding the epidemiology of IMD outbreaks is essential for effective control.

Observation:

  • Two temporally related cases of invasive meningococcal disease occurred within a single day-care center classroom.
  • This cluster prompted an epidemiologic investigation and the implementation of control measures.
  • Literature review confirmed increased risk for secondary spread among day-care contacts.

Findings:

  • Prompt reporting of IMD cases to local health departments is critical for timely intervention.
  • Rifampin prophylaxis is indicated for appropriate contacts of IMD cases to prevent secondary infections.
  • Immunization should be considered in select circumstances during IMD outbreaks.

Implications:

  • Effective control of IMD in day-care settings requires a multi-faceted approach.
  • Early detection, reporting, and targeted prophylaxis can mitigate the spread of meningococcal disease.
  • Public health strategies must adapt to the unique challenges of infectious disease transmission in child-care environments.
